Home Feedback Info

Departures for St Mark's Church (Stop E), on Westmoreland Road, Bromley [71153]

11 departures - 13/10/2025 11:25:16

[Refresh Departures]

367

Bromley North Station at 11:28

119

Bromley North Station at 11:30

352

Bromley North Station at 11:33

162

Eltham Bus Station at 11:34

314

Eltham Bus Station at 11:34

138

Bromley North Station at 11:39

246

Bromley North Station at 11:41

119

Bromley North Station at 11:42

314

Eltham Bus Station at 11:46

367

Bromley North Station at 11:48

[Show Stop on Map]

[Show Nearby Stops]

Page 1 of 2 Next